Grav是一个基于文件的开源内容管理系统(CMS),它使用Twig作为模板引擎。Twig是一个现代化的PHP模板引擎,它提供了一种简洁、安全和高效的方式来生成动态内容。
在Grav中使用快捷代码是通过Twig模板语言来实现的。Twig提供了一些内置的快捷代码,可以帮助开发者更方便地处理数据和生成内容。
快捷代码可以用于各种场景,包括但不限于:
date
过滤器将日期格式化为特定的格式,或使用slice
函数截取数组的一部分。if
语句进行条件判断,可以根据不同的条件来生成不同的内容。例如,可以根据用户的登录状态显示不同的导航菜单。for
循环语句,可以对数组或对象进行迭代操作。这样可以方便地生成重复的内容,例如生成一个产品列表。include
语句将其他模板文件包含到当前模板中。这样可以将一些通用的部分抽离出来,提高代码的复用性。推荐的腾讯云相关产品和产品介绍链接地址: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云